Ameritrade and Delta Air Lines Launch Partnership

Ameritrade Holding Corporation (Nasdaq:  AMTD), is pleased to announce a new marketing partnership with Delta Air Lines (NYSE: DAL).  The program offers Delta SkyMiles* members up to 25,000 miles for opening a new Ameritrade® brokerage account.

“By creating marketing alliances with industry-leading brands, we provide additional opportunities for self-directed investors choosing Ameritrade for their investing needs,” said Anne Nelson, Ameritrade’s chief marketing officer.  “The partnership with Delta reflects our commitment to providing our clients superior experience and value.”

This offer is tiered to appeal to many types of investors.  SkyMiles members may earn*:

á 3,000 miles when opening a new account with a minimum of $1,000 á 8,000 miles for a new account opened with a minimum of $5,000 á 25,000 miles for a new account opened with a minimum of $50,000


“Ameritrade provides a valuable service to customers who need to efficiently manage their portfolios while traveling throughout the world,” said Christine Pierce, Delta’s director of Partnership Marketing.  “Delta is pleased to offer SkyMiles members this new opportunity to earn miles.”

Delta SkyMiles members earn mileage by flying Delta, the Delta Connection carriers, Delta Express, Delta Shuttle and Delta`s airline partners, including Delta`s SkyTeam partners.  The Delta SkyMiles program offers many other mileage-building opportunities, including the Delta SkyMiles® Credit Card from American Express, MCI® telecommunication services, Nextel® wireless services, EarthLink internet services, participating hotels, car rental companies, restaurants, home buying and selling, cruise line and flower purchases.  The SkyMiles program received InsideFlyer’s Industry Impact Award for its industry-leading and customer-focused response to the tragic events of September 11.

Delta Air Lines, the world’s second largest carrier in terms of passengers carried and the leading U.S. airline across the Atlantic, offers 5,696 flights each day to 417 destinations in 73 countries on Delta, Delta Express, Delta Shuttle, Delta Connection and Delta’s worldwide partners.  Delta is a founding member of SkyTeam, a global airline alliance that provides customers with extensive worldwide destinations, flights and services.  For more information, please go to www.delta.com.

Ameritrade Holding Corporation (www.amtd.com) is a pioneer in the online brokerage industry with a 27-year history of providing clients a self-directed approach to investment services.  The award-winning Company, through its Private Client and Institutional Client divisions, provides tiered levels of brokerage products and services tailored to meet the varying investing, trading and execution needs of individual investors, financial institutions and corporations.
